• تلفن : 07633620111
  • ایمیل : info@bndlearn.ir

بلوار امام،روبروی پارک صفا،ساختمان آفتاب،طبقه اول

شرح

جاوا اسکریپت (JavaScript) یک زبان برنامه‌نویسی قدرتمند و پرکاربرد است که به‌ویژه در توسعه وب استفاده می‌شود. این زبان به وب‌سایت‌ها امکان می‌دهد تا تعامل‌پذیری و کارایی بیشتری داشته باشند. در ادامه به ویژگی‌ها، مزایا و کاربردهای جاوا اسکریپت می‌پردازیم.

ویژگی‌های کلیدی جاوا اسکریپت

  1. زبان اسکریپتی سمت کاربر:

    • جاوا اسکریپت به‌عنوان یک زبان اسکریپتی سمت کاربر (Client-Side) شناخته می‌شود، به این معنی که کدهای آن در مرورگر کاربران اجرا می‌شود. این ویژگی باعث کاهش بار سرور و افزایش سرعت بارگذاری صفحات می‌شود.
  2. تعامل‌پذیری بالا:

    • جاوا اسکریپت به توسعه‌دهندگان این امکان را می‌دهد تا با استفاده از DOM (Document Object Model)، عناصر HTML را به‌طور داینامیک تغییر دهند و واکنش‌ها به تعاملات کاربر (مانند کلیک، حرکت ماوس و ورودی در فرم‌ها) را مدیریت کنند.
  3. پشتیبانی از برنامه‌نویسی شی‌گرا و تابعی:

    • جاوا اسکریپت از هر دو الگوی برنامه‌نویسی شی‌گرا و تابعی پشتیبانی می‌کند. این قابلیت به توسعه‌دهندگان این امکان را می‌دهد که به‌صورت انعطاف‌پذیرتر کدهای خود را سازمان‌دهی و مدیریت کنند.
  4. کتابخانه‌ها و فریمورک‌های متنوع:

    • کتابخانه‌ها و فریمورک‌های قدرتمند مانند jQuery، React، Angular و Vue.js به توسعه‌دهندگان کمک می‌کنند تا به‌سرعت و به‌راحتی اپلیکیشن‌های پیچیده بسازند.
  5. عملکرد عالی:

    • جاوا اسکریپت به‌طور مداوم در حال پیشرفت و بهینه‌سازی است. موتورهای جاوا اسکریپت مانند V8 (که در مرورگر Chrome استفاده می‌شود) به این زبان اجازه می‌دهند تا با سرعت بالا اجرا شود.

کاربردهای جاوا اسکریپت

  1. توسعه وب:

    • جاوا اسکریپت یکی از اجزای اصلی تکنولوژی‌های وب به حساب می‌آید و تقریباً همه وب‌سایت‌های مدرن از آن برای افزودن تعاملات و ویژگی‌های داینامیک استفاده می‌کنند.
  2. ساختن اپلیکیشن‌های وب و SPA (Single Page Applications):

    • فریمورک‌های مانند React و Angular به توسعه‌دهندگان این امکان را می‌دهند تا اپلیکیشن‌های وب یکپارچه (SPA) بسازند، که در آن فقط صفحه‌ای خاص بارگذاری می‌شود و بدون نیاز به بارگذاری مجدد، محتویات آن تغییر می‌کند.
  3. برنامه‌نویسی سمت سرور (Node.js):

    • با استفاده از Node.js، جاوا اسکریپت می‌تواند در سمت سرور نیز اجرا شود، که این امکان را می‌دهد تا توسعه‌دهندگان با یک زبان برای هر دو سمت (کلاینت و سرور) برنامه‌نویسی کنند.
  4. توسعه موبایل:

    • فریمورک‌هایی مانند React Native به توسعه‌دهندگان این امکان را می‌دهند که با استفاده از جاوا اسکریپت، اپلیکیشن‌های موبایلی برای iOS و Android بسازند.
  5. بازی‌های آنلاین:

    • با استفاده از کتابخانه‌های مانند Phaser، می‌توان بازی‌های وب را با جاوا اسکریپت توسعه داد.

چرا باید جاوا اسکریپت یاد بگیرید؟

  • تقاضای بالا در بازار کار: جاوا اسکریپت یکی از پرتقاضاترین مهارت‌ها در بازار کار فناوری اطلاعات است. بسیاری از شرکت‌ها به دنبال توسعه‌دهندگان ماهر در این زبان هستند.

  • پشتیبانی قوی از جامعه: با داشتن یک جامعه گسترده و فعال، منابع آموزشی، مستندات و پشتیبانی از طرف سایر توسعه‌دهندگان در دسترس است.

  • فرصت‌های شغلی متنوع: یادگیری جاوا اسکریپت می‌تواند به فرصتی برای حرفه‌ای شدن در زمینه‌های مختلفی از جمله توسعه وب، برنامه‌نویسی سمت سرور، توسعه اپلیکیشن‌های موبایل و بازی‌‌سازی تبدیل شود.

 

 

نظر

پیغام گذاشتن

سوالات متداول

آموزش های مرتبط

لاراول۲
برنامه نویسی وب
  • 0 درس
  • 8:20 ساعت
9,800,000 تومان
مبانی هوش مصنوعی +استفاده از ابزارهای هوش مصنوعی
برنامه نویسی وب
دوره آموزشی باگ بانتی وب(وب هکینگ)
برنامه نویسی وب
PHP (ترم۴)
برنامه نویسی وب
  • 0 درس
  • 1:40 ساعت
7,980,000 تومان
bootstrap(پروژه محور)
برنامه نویسی وب
  • 14 درس
  • 5:00 ساعت
6,480,000 تومان
صفر تا صد جاوا اسکریپت
برنامه نویسی وب
  • 0 درس
  • 13:20 ساعت
7,980,000 تومان
آموزش لاراول
برنامه نویسی وب
  • 18 درس
  • 0:50 ساعت
8,980,000 تومان
آموزش Html&Css
برنامه نویسی وب
  • 10 درس
  • 1:40 ساعت
5,480,000 تومان
498,000 / 4,980,000 تومان

درباره ما

کالج تخصصی برنامه نویسی

لینک های مفید

نمادها